Grand Prix & Ladies Grand Prix Scoring System
After all the tournaments have been played in a calendar year, the AEBBA will invite the top 16 players based on performances throughout the year in those tournaments to play in the prestigious Grand Prix. In addition the top 8 ladies will be invited to play in the Ladies Grand Prix.
How the scoring system works.
Any open individual event contributes points towards the final points tally for each player. For example in 2010 these tournaments were –
Oxon Open Portsmouth Open Guernsey Open Surrey Open Sussex Open Kent Classic Bucks Open Berks Open World Championship Singles

The finals positions of the players will be decided on the following criteria
a) Total Grand Prix Points b) Total Events that points have been scored in c) Total Matches Won in all events d) Total Events played in.
In the event of a tie a play off will be arranged only if it is for the final place. Otherwise a coin toss will determine the final positions
For ladies to qualify they must have scored at least one point in open event as well as be in the top 16 overall
The Grand Prix
The Grand Prix will be the last event that takes place in the calendar year (usually a week before the All England AGM The top 16 players will be invited and if any are unable to attend the players on the list from 17th onwards will be invited one by one until we have a full field of 16.

The following dress code will apply
All players should wear smart shirt, bow tie and waistcoat, black trousers and black shoes. Ladies may wear blouse and skirt.
The Ladies Grand Prix
The Ladies Grand Prix take place on the same day as the Open Grand Prix The top 8 lady players will be invited and if any are unable to attend the players on the list from 9th onwards will be invited one by one until we have a full field of 8.
The scoring system is the same as above, but to qualify a lady does not have to have score at least 1 point in an open event

If you a lady has qualified for both the Open Grand Prix as well as the Ladies Grand Prix they must advise as to which tournament they wish to enter as they cannot play in both.
